UNC womens’ basketball downs Weber State on the road, 73-60

- By Jadyn Watson Fisher jwatson-fisher@ greeleytri­bune.com

Weber State’s mascot is the wildcat for a reason. The home team made things wild for the University of Northern Colorado women’s basketball team on Monday night.

UNC (11-12, 4-8 Big Sky) defeated Weber State (5-17, 1- 9 Big Sky), 73- 60, in its best offensive performanc­e of the conference schedule and the best since scoring 72 points against South Dakota in December.

The Bears jumped out to a strong lead in the first half, limiting the Cats to 18 points, while racking up 33 of their own. From offense to defense, the team outperform­ed the Cats in just about every statistic.

Weber State’s offense started to heat up after the break and the Northern Colorado defense couldn’t quite stop it as effectivel­y. In fact, the Wildcats were down by as many as 17 points but trimmed the Bears’ lead to just eight points twice.

Still, UNC continued to have an answer on the offensive end, thanks to double digit scoring from three players. Junior Delaynie Byrne finished with 23 points, just one off her career high.

After struggling for weeks to get shots to fall, it was the kind of game it needed. The defense wasn’t perfect the entire way, but it put together a performanc­e it can learn from.

Northern Colorado continues its week on the road Thursday. It plays at 7 p. m. against Portland State.

• Delaynie Byrne: 23 PTS, 8 REB, 1 AST

• Hannah Simental: 16 PTS, 3 REB, 5 AST

• Averee Kleinhans: 14 PTS, 6 AST, 3 STL

• UNC shooting: 23- 47 FG, 6-16 3FG, 21-26 FT

• UNC other: 30 REB (4 OREB), 15 AST, 7 STL, 4 BLK, 20 PF, 13 TO

• Weber State shooting: 23-61 FG, 5-14 3FG, 9-15 FT

• Weber State other: 33 REB (13 OREB), 12 AST, 5 STL, 6 BLK, 25 PF, 14 TO
